摘要
In the context of the low-carbon transition, enhancing green innovation efficiency (GIE) emerges as a vital pathway for the manufacturing industry to achieve sustainability. However, within the ongoing wave of digital transformation (DT), there is limited research addressing the connection between DT and GIE in manufacturing firms. Drawing from the resource-based view and resource dependency theory, this research aims to evaluate the potential of DT in driving GIE by analyzing data from 682 publicly listed manufacturing firms in China between 2011 and 2021. Our findings indicate that DT exerts a notable and positive influence on GIE. Meanwhile, this study identifies improving management efficiency as the mediating pathway through which DT affects GIE. Additionally, R&D subsidies positively moderate the beneficial impact of DT on GIE. Lastly, state-owned companies derive greater benefits in terms of GIE from the process of DT.
